If time is flexible, I would arrive around 11a or so and let the greeter know your status and preference - if asked nicely, they should radio down to the returns area and ask the clean-up staff to find what you want. Worst case, you'll need to wait up to a couple hours for a specific car to make its way from the return lane (if the lane is jammed, walk over there first to see if there is something you want, then write down the VIN/barcode number) through clean-up.
If you see something in the return lane, take the VIN/barcode to the supervisor on duty (if they're in the return area, just point at the car), explain your status and ask if the car can be taken for priority clean-up and brought to you over in the Aisle pick-up area.
